From publisher blurb:
Over a century ago, the vile ‘Brotherhood of the Fallen’ unleashed a horrifying reign of terror upon the town of Redvale. Yet while the cult was ultimately vanquished by the legendary hero, Alexander Winterlight, the deep mental and physical scars which Redvale’s people suffered at the hands of the Brotherhood remained. For years, the town’s citizens lived with the constant fear that the Brotherhood may one day return to plague Redvale once more, but over the ensuing decades, memory of the atrocities which the cult perpetrated began to fade. This all changed but a few short months ago… when the Brotherhood’s lost temple was seemingly uncovered in a nearby mountain range, a discovery that threatened to shatter the peace and serenity which the people of Redvale had enjoyed of late.
Since the temple’s seeming discovery, a number of strange events have occurred in and around Redvale, events that have led the people of the town to wonder if the Brotherhood has truly returned, or if there could perhaps be some other sinister force at work within their midst? If only Redvale’s council could find a group of brave (or perhaps foolhardy) souls who would be willing to step forth and pit themselves against the menace that is… The Brotherhood of the Fallen!!!
The Brotherhood of the Fallen is an adventure designed for characters of 1st to 3rd level. Yet those who are brave enough to pit their wits against the Brotherhood will need far more than a strong sword arm, as intrigue abounds within the town of Redvale, while all manner of fiendish traps and puzzles lie within the cult’s temple. So ask yourself this; are you truly ready to face the dangers which lie within?!
The Brotherhood of the Fallen contains a 38-page Introduction Book and a 109-page Adventure Book, along with numerous maps and player handouts.
